[ ] {S} Estimate all the top-level tasks with T-shirt sizes: S, M, L, XL
[ ] {S} Use the Terminal in your computer to:
create a W.I.P branch of your restaurant_review repo.
[ ] Add and commit your work.
[ ] Push your commits to Github.
[ ] In Github, open a PR.
[ ] {L} Level 1
[ ] Hide the form for adding a new review, and make it appear in response to clicking on a link that says "Add a review".
[ ] When a new review is added, have it appear at top of the review list rather than generating a whole new page.
[ ] Reviews should include links to edit or delete them, but only when they are viewed by the user who created them. Place the edit link and delete button for a review in the same
tag as the "Posted by" information. If a review is deleted, remove it from the list without generating a whole new page.
[ ] {XL} Expert level
Have the edit link and delete button present in a user's reviews but be invisible unless the user is hovering over the containing
tag.
[ ] Remove the delete button for reviews posted more than an hour ago.
Nightmare level
[ ] Have the form for editing a review appear right underneath the review. When the form is submitted, replace the old version of the review with the new one, and add a visible signal that a change occurred.
[ ] {XXL} Include a link to let a user cancel the edit before submitting it.
[ ] {S} End of day wiki edit
[ ] Add your thoughts on this assignment to the Assignment Evaluation page.
[ ] Update Light Bulbs and Things I Don't Get Yet to reflect how you feel at the end of the day.
tag as the "Posted by" information. If a review is deleted, remove it from the list without generating a whole new page.
tag.